eterinary Specialists of the Rockies is seeking a compassionate and motivated Veterinary Assistant to join our specialty and referral hospital team. This is an excellent opportunity for an assistant who th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ment and is dedicated to providing exceptional patient care while building meaningful relationships with clients and their pets. As a Veterinary Assistant, you will play an essential role in supporting our veterinarians and specialty teams, ensuring efficient workflows and a positive experience for both patients and clients. This position is ideal for individuals who excel in patient handling, client communication, and multitasking within a high-level medical setting. Key Responsibilities Assist veterinarians and veterinary technicians with procedures and outpatient treatments to support efficient, high-quality care Obtain high-quality diagnostic radiographs in accordance with hospital protocols and safety standards Perform in-house laboratory testing accurately and efficiently Communicate clearly and compassionately with clients, including reviewing treatment plans, discharge instructions, and answering questions professionally Accurately document and maintain detailed medical records Maintain cleanliness and organization of exam rooms, treatment areas, and equipment to ensure a safe and sanitary hospital environment Schedule This is a full-time position, with a 4/10 schedule Saturday - Wednesday swing or overnight. Compensation & Benefits Hourly pay: $16.50 - $17.50 , based on experience Medical, dental, and vision insurance 401(k) options Paid time off Employee pet care discount Uniform allowance Minimum Qualifications & Skills At least 1 year of veterinary assistant experience in a clinical setting (specialty experience preferred but not required) Proficiency in: Client communication Animal restraint Outpatient care General hospital cleaning and organization About Us Veterinary Specialists of the Rockies delivers advanced, compassionate medical care to pets while supporting a trusted network of referring veterinarians throughout the region. Our 10,000-square-foot, state-of-the-art facility is equipped with CT, ultrasound, digital radiography, an in-house laboratory and pharmacy, and multiple surgical suites. We provide specialty services in Emergency Medicine, Surgery, Oncology, and Critical Care.
